Australia was a revelation for me. In 2000, I went to a harvest campaign in Victoria at Pfeiffer wines. The contact with this other land, the detachment with France, these men of the bush, all this brought down all my artificial programming and restarted my aboriginal programming of the world.
It was in 2013 that I decided to paint like the Australian Aborigines, following a divorce from music, because I had lived with it for too long and never understood it. The stencil brush well in hand, plunging into the color, three quarter turns in circles on the canvas, I began another adventure that reminded me of the work of champagne bottle turners, three quarter turns every day to bring down the fermentation deposit in the neck. I was saved, I felt myself growing wings, flying over lakes, cliffs, towns, rivers.
